The flint street nativity by tim firth exposes what an ungodly snake pit of paediatric powerpolitics the staging of your average nativity play can be. The story is based on real events, collected over a period of ten years from members of tim firths family and friends who were teachers. This hilarious as well as poignant play within a play is a portrayal of the nativity by the 7year old children of flint street junior school in which the characters are all played by adults who later in the play portray the parents of the children, thus exposing the source of the childrens characteristics. The flint street nativity is a 1999 british television comedy film directed by marcus mortimer, written by tim firth, and starring frank skinner, neil morrissey, jane horrocks, john thomson, stephen tompkinson, mark addy, ralf little, julia sawalha, mina anwar and dervla kirwan.
